Commercial Slab Construction in Columbus, OH
Commercial slab construction services involve the creation of solid, durable concrete foundations for a variety of property projects. This service covers the development of concrete slabs used in building parking lots, walkways, loading docks, storage areas, and other flat surfaces essential for commercial properties. Property owners typically seek this service when planning new construction, expansion, or renovation projects that require a stable and long-lasting base to support heavy equipment, vehicles, or foot traffic.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the size and thickness of the slab, site preparation requirements, and any necessary permits or zoning considerations. It’s also important to consider the intended use of the area, as different applications may require specific reinforcement or finishing techniques. Clear communication about these details helps ensure the completed slab meets the structural needs and longevity expectations for the property.

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s
Commercial slab foundations - essential for supporting large commercial buildings and retail spaces.
Parking lot slabs - durable surfaces designed to withstand vehicle traffic and heavy loads.
Warehouse floors - flat, strong concrete slabs that facilitate efficient storage and movement.
Loading dock slabs - reinforced concrete areas built to handle the weight of trucks and freight.
Sidewalk and walkway slabs - safe, level surfaces for pedestrian access around commercial properties.
Industrial floor slabs - specialized concrete work for factories and manufacturing facilities.
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are typically used for building foundations, parking lots, walkways, and loading areas on business properties.
What factors influence the durability of a commercial slab? The quality of materials, proper site preparation, and adequate reinforcement help ensure a durable slab suitable for heavy use.
How is the size of a commercial slab determined? The size depends on the specific project requirements, including the building layout, load capacity, and property dimensions.
What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? It’s important to evaluate the intended use, soil conditions, and drainage needs to ensure a stable and long-lasting foundation.
